Transaction 57d312b9bb57834411031d3936f2d53b2e6ae873733e27f99033c79d9a94d2c8
1 Input
2 Outputs
- 57d312b9bb57834411031d3936f2d53b2e6ae873733e27f99033c79d9a94d2c8:0
- 57d312b9bb57834411031d3936f2d53b2e6ae873733e27f99033c79d9a94d2c8:1
value 40343
address 1FJv5aXqAJVPe4LRoT5DiSHGyVG4gidu9s
value 2438904
address 3B3qkb8SSq2NUY3wPeEaGX1SLLFwkptAyn